Genetic diversity in kashubs: the regional increase in the frequency of several disease-causing variants

HIGHLIGHTS

  • who: Maciej Jankowski from the Department of Biology and Medical Genetics, Medical University of Gdansk, Gdansk, Poland have published the article: Genetic diversity in Kashubs: the regional increase in the frequency of several disease-causing variants, in the Journal: (JOURNAL)
  • future: Studies are needed to compare the haplotype background and to estimate age of c.3700_3704del in Kashubs and in other European populations.
